Megan Thee Stallion is done hibernating; the rapper dropped her very first single in 2024, "Hiss," which still follows the theme and concept of her last release "Cobra."

According to reports, Thee Stallion did not waste any time introducing listeners to her new song, which opens with "I just wanna kick this s-t off by saying, 'F**k y'all!"

"I ain't gotta clear my name on a motherf**kin' thang. (Every time) I get mentioned, one of y'all b***h a*s n***as get 24 hours of attention. I'm finna get this s-t off my chest and lay it to rest, let's go!" The Houston native raps.

With her pointed and deliberate lyrics, the rapper seems to be on a roll and does not have time to look back, instead, she is charging forward.

In fact, the new track stepped on the toes of one of hip-hop's biggest stars, Nicki Minaj, who immediately took notice of one line.

Megan Thee Stallion Shades Everyone Who Did Her Wrong

XXL Magazine noted that Thee Stallion dissed Minaj and her husband Kenneth Petty with the lyrics: "These hoes don't be mad at Megan, these hoes mad at Megan's Law/I don't really know what the problem is, but I guarantee y'all don't want me to start/B***h, you a p***y (You a p***y), never finna check me (Yeah)."

"Megan's Law" refers to the federal law requiring law enforcement to make information about registered sex offenders available to the public.

Petty is a convicted sex offender who was convicted after raping a 16-year-old girl several years ago; he was also hit with a fine and probation after failing to register as a sex offender in 2020.

Aside from the "Super Bass" rapper and Petty, Thee Stallion also came after her previous label, 1501 Certified Entertainment and Tory Lanez, who was convicted of shooting her in the foot in 2020.

Megan Thee Stallion Reacts to Nicki Minaj's Diss Track

According to reports, Minaj took to Instagram Live to respond to "Hiss." The rapper shared a snippet of an unreleased, untitled track.

"Bad b*t**h she like 6 foot, I call her big foot. The b***h fell off, I said get up on your good foot," the rapper's vocals rang throughout the recording studio.

Thee Stallion reacted to the diss track via her Instagram Story, she was seen laughing uncontrollably.
